Ticket: Lost badge — replacement procedure

Logging a lost staff badge for a colleague in the Quillon Annex. As per procedure, the old badge has been deactivated and a replacement requested with photo verification completed at the desk. Until the new badge is printed, the colleague should use the temporary access code provided below.

staff pass of kagup-fajog = bdg-QCHVQW-99665837

Scope: emergency admin access to the SproutCycle plant-watering scheduler when normal SSO is down.

Use only if: watering jobs are stalled >30 min and on-call cannot authenticate.

Procedure: open the break-glass console, select the prod tenant, and unseal the local credential store. Log the incident within one hour; access auto-revokes after 90 minutes. Rotation of the break-glass secret happens every release cut — release manager owns this. Current recovery passphrase for the credential store follows.

vault phrase of taweg-kafof = oliax-zorael

# Env file — Slatemark Diagram Editor (review copy)
# The undo/redo stack in Slatemark is persisted server-side so sessions
# can resume after a crash; history entries are encrypted at rest.
# UNDO_DEPTH and REDO_WINDOW below are safe defaults; do not raise them
# without review. The encryption key for the history store is set on the
# line that follows.

sealed setting: VAULT_KEY20=c8ea1e419912889df6b4